#f54f86 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f54f86 is composed of 96.1% red, 31%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.8% magenta, 45.3%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 340.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 63.5%. #f54f86 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9eff with #eb000d.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#f54f86 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f54f86 has RGB values of R:245, G:79,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.45,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16076678.

Shades and Tints of #f54f86
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0104 is the darkest color, while #fef6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f54f86
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a69ea1 is the less saturated color, while #fc4884 is the most saturated one.
